US to join Ukraine energy summit in May

KIEV, Jan. 23 – The United States on Wednesday agreed to join an energy summit in Kiev later this year, a move that supports Ukraine’s attempts to arrange alternative to Russia’s supplies of oil and natural gas.

Ukraine seeks to provide tax breaks to CNG-filling stations

KIEV, Jan. 23 ??“ The Ukrainian government will seek to draft legislation providing tax breaks to companies building filling stations that use compressed natural gas (CNG) as fuel, energy and fuel minister Yuriy Boyko said.


NBU spends $500 mln to support hryvnia over three weeks, aide says

KIEV, Jan. 23 ??“ The National Bank of Ukraine spent about $500 million over the past three weeks supporting the hryvnia as demand for hard currency had increased due to growing gas imports, an official said.

Economy to grow at slower rate in 2006 due to gas price hike

KIEV, Jan. 23 - Ukraine's economy will probably expand 2.4% this year, a half of what has been originally planned, due to a sharp increase in natural gas prices, Economy Ministry Arseniy Yatseniuk said.

Russia, Ukraine work on 5-year nuclear fuel supply agreement

KIEV, Jan. 23 ??“ Ukraine and Russia are preparing a new agreement on nuclear fuel supplies to Ukrainian NPPs in 2006-2010 inclusive, Russian Atomic Energy Agency (Rosatom) chief Sergei Kiriyenko said.
